متن کاملSingle cell nanobiosensors for dynamic gene expression profiling in native tissue microenvironments.
A gold nanorod-locked nucleic acid nano-biosensor for dynamic single-cell gene expression analysis in living cells and tissues is developed. The nanoparticle facilitates endocytic delivery and dynamic monitoring of the gene expression in human umbilical cord endothelial cells, mouse skin tissues, mouse retina tissues, and mouse cornea tissues at the single-cell level.
